veriblock-pop-cpp
C++11 Libraries for leveraging VeriBlock Proof-Of-Proof blockchain technology.
altintegration::MemPool Member List

This is the complete list of members for altintegration::MemPool, including all inherited members.

atv_map_t typedef (defined in altintegration::MemPool)altintegration::MemPool
atv_value_sorted_map_t typedef (defined in altintegration::MemPool)altintegration::MemPool
cleanUp()altintegration::MemPool
clear()altintegration::MemPool
FAILED_STATEFUL enum value (defined in altintegration::MemPool)altintegration::MemPool
FAILED_STATELESS enum value (defined in altintegration::MemPool)altintegration::MemPool
generatePopData()altintegration::MemPool
generatePopData(const std::function< void(const ATV &, const ValidationState &)> &onATV, const std::function< void(const VTB &, const ValidationState &)> &onVTB, const std::function< void(const VbkBlock &, const ValidationState &)> &onVBK)altintegration::MemPool
get(const typename T::id_t &id) constaltintegration::MemPoolinline
getInFlightMap() constaltintegration::MemPool
getMap() constaltintegration::MemPool
getMissingBtcBlocks() const (defined in altintegration::MemPool)altintegration::MemPool
isKnown(const typename T::id_t &id, const bool onlyInMempool=false) constaltintegration::MemPoolinline
MemPool(AltBlockTree &tree) (defined in altintegration::MemPool)altintegration::MemPool
on_atv_acceptedaltintegration::MemPool
on_vbkblock_acceptedaltintegration::MemPool
on_vtb_acceptedaltintegration::MemPool
onAccepted(std::function< void(const T &p)> f)altintegration::MemPoolinline
payload_map typedef (defined in altintegration::MemPool)altintegration::MemPool
payload_value_sorted_map typedef (defined in altintegration::MemPool)altintegration::MemPool
relations_map_t typedef (defined in altintegration::MemPool)altintegration::MemPool
removeAll(const PopData &popData)altintegration::MemPool
Status enum name (defined in altintegration::MemPool)altintegration::MemPool
submit(Slice< const uint8_t > bytes, bool doIsBlockOldCheck, ValidationState &state)altintegration::MemPoolinline
submit(const T &pl, bool doIsBlockOldCheck, ValidationState &state)altintegration::MemPoolinline
submit(const std::shared_ptr< T > &pl, bool doIsBlockOldCheck, ValidationState &state)altintegration::MemPoolinline
submit(const std::shared_ptr< ATV > &atv, bool doIsBlockOldCheck, ValidationState &state)altintegration::MemPool
submit(const std::shared_ptr< VTB > &vtb, bool doIsBlockOldCheck, ValidationState &state)altintegration::MemPool
submit(const std::shared_ptr< VbkBlock > &block, bool doIsBlockOldCheck, ValidationState &state)altintegration::MemPool
VALID enum value (defined in altintegration::MemPool)altintegration::MemPool
vbk_hash_t typedef (defined in altintegration::MemPool)altintegration::MemPool
vbk_map_t typedef (defined in altintegration::MemPool)altintegration::MemPool
vbk_value_sorted_map_t typedef (defined in altintegration::MemPool)altintegration::MemPool
vtb_map_t typedef (defined in altintegration::MemPool)altintegration::MemPool
vtb_value_sorted_map_t typedef (defined in altintegration::MemPool)altintegration::MemPool
~MemPool()=default (defined in altintegration::MemPool)altintegration::MemPool